Nvidia CEO Jensen Huang Tells Joe Rogan AI Race Is Real, But It Won’t Have a Clear Winner
Summary
Nvidia CEO Jensen Huang, in an interview with Joe Rogan, characterized the current push for AI leadership as a continuation of historical technological competition, similar to the Manhattan Project. He believes AI will advance in waves, with continuous gains rather than a single decisive breakthrough. Huang highlighted the rapid progress of AI – becoming 100 times more capable in the last two years – but countered fears about autonomous weapons by emphasizing improvements in functionality and safety. He also defended the U.S. military’s involvement in AI development, suggesting it promotes accountability. Huang envisions AI ultimately becoming a ubiquitous infrastructure, seamlessly integrated into daily life rather than a dominant intelligence.
